CASTLE ROCK, Colo. (AP) - A CIA contractor who was once jailed in Pakistan for killing two men in a shootout is due in a Colorado courtroom on charges of fighting over a shopping center parking spot.

Raymond Davis was arrested Saturday on charges of third-degree assault and disorderly conduct.

A hearing is scheduled for Monday in a court in Castle Rock just south of Denver.

Sheriff's deputies say the altercation took place outside an Einstein Bagel shop in Highlands Ranch south of Denver. Few details have been released.

In January, Davis said he shot two Pakistani men who tried to rob him. He was released in March under a deal that paid the victims' families $2.34 million in "blood money" under Islamic tradition.

Pakistan's security agencies came under intense domestic criticism for freeing him.
